Dominic Cooper's older fans
Mar 27, 2010, 10:30 GMT
Dominic Cooper gets chased down the street by "middle-aged women".
The 'Mamma Mia!' actor says he has been bombarded with female attention since starring in the 2008 ABBA-inspired musical movie and says he still can't escape his adoring fans.
He said: "I get middle-aged women chasing me down the street. It's definitely due to 'Mamma Mia!'. I was blissfully unaware of how the business worked. Once people recognise you, it changes your position in terms of the people you meet and the opportunities you then have for more work. The whole thing was a delightful experience."
However, Dominic - who is dating his 'Mamma Mia!' co-star Amanda Seyfried - says it won't stop him from living a normal life.
He said: "I think it's important to live in the real world. I remember the playwright Alan Bennett saying, 'As a writer you must stay about the people you write about.' As an actor, you can't not travel on the underground."
